New issue
Advanced search Search tips

Issue 832896 link

Starred by 1 user

Issue metadata

Status: Verified
Owner:
Closed: Apr 2018
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Linux , Windows , Mac
Pri: 2
Type: Bug



Sign in to add a comment

Enterprise reporting Extension API helper

Project Member Reported by zmin@chromium.org, Apr 13 2018

Issue description

Request to merge the Extension API of enterprise reporting to 67.

https://chromium-review.googlesource.com/c/chromium/src/+/986946

This is the follow up of  issue 832887  as a release blocker for TT.
 
Project Member

Comment 1 by sheriffbot@chromium.org, Apr 14 2018

Labels: -Merge-Request-67 Merge-Approved-67 Hotlist-Merge-Approved
Your change meets the bar and is auto-approved for M67. Please go ahead and merge the CL to branch 3396 manually. Please contact milestone owner if you have questions.
Owners: cmasso@(Android), cmasso@(iOS), kbleicher@(ChromeOS), govind@(Desktop)

For more details visit https://www.chromium.org/issue-tracking/autotriage - Your friendly Sheriffbot
Project Member

Comment 2 by bugdroid1@chromium.org, Apr 15 2018

Labels: -merge-approved-67 merge-merged-3396
The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/d6f9bf745b118e7d12d8b1e01782070477760da4

commit d6f9bf745b118e7d12d8b1e01782070477760da4
Author: Owen Min <zmin@chromium.org>
Date: Sun Apr 15 00:36:10 2018

Implement a helper function that builds ChromeDesktopReportRequest.

Building the protobuf based on
Input from extension API:
1) Machine name
2) OS information (x86/x64)
3) OS User
4) Chrome Profile and its extensions/plugins
Other information that is stored in Chrome.
1) OS Information (Platform name and its version)
2) Browser version/channel.
3) Current profile ID based on its path
4) All policies affect the current profile.

Please note that only one profile will be added into the report.

Bug:  832896 

Change-Id: I703ff554932388611c9839473b7dcadcf0cac3c1
Reviewed-on: https://chromium-review.googlesource.com/986946
Commit-Queue: Owen Min <zmin@chromium.org>
Reviewed-by: Karan Bhatia <karandeepb@chromium.org>
Reviewed-by: Marc-André Decoste <mad@chromium.org>
Cr-Original-Commit-Position: refs/heads/master@{#550596}(cherry picked from commit 614a8266aafcbc072a4459ddc57006cf78d43de1)
Reviewed-on: https://chromium-review.googlesource.com/1013341
Reviewed-by: Owen Min <zmin@chromium.org>
Cr-Commit-Position: refs/branch-heads/3396@{#9}
Cr-Branched-From: 9ef2aa869bc7bc0c089e255d698cca6e47d6b038-refs/heads/master@{#550428}
[modify] https://crrev.com/d6f9bf745b118e7d12d8b1e01782070477760da4/chrome/browser/extensions/BUILD.gn
[add] https://crrev.com/d6f9bf745b118e7d12d8b1e01782070477760da4/chrome/browser/extensions/api/enterprise_reporting_private/chrome_desktop_report_request_helper.cc
[add] https://crrev.com/d6f9bf745b118e7d12d8b1e01782070477760da4/chrome/browser/extensions/api/enterprise_reporting_private/chrome_desktop_report_request_helper.h
[add] https://crrev.com/d6f9bf745b118e7d12d8b1e01782070477760da4/chrome/browser/extensions/api/enterprise_reporting_private/chrome_desktop_report_request_helper_unittest.cc
[modify] https://crrev.com/d6f9bf745b118e7d12d8b1e01782070477760da4/chrome/browser/extensions/api/enterprise_reporting_private/enterprise_reporting_private_api.cc
[modify] https://crrev.com/d6f9bf745b118e7d12d8b1e01782070477760da4/chrome/test/BUILD.gn

Comment 3 by zmin@chromium.org, Apr 30 2018

Status: Verified (was: Assigned)

Sign in to add a comment